Gail Milburn is a Senior Lecturer in Dental Nursing at Teesside University, specializing in Allied Health Professions. She contributes to curriculum development and serves as an admissions tutor, promoting dental nursing education while pursuing a BA (Hons) in Educational Studies to enhance her academic career.
- Education: National Certificate in Dental Surgery Assistance (New College Durham), Diploma in Dental Hygiene (Newcastle Dental Hospital), Postgraduate Certificate in Education (Middlesbrough College).
Research Interests: Gail focuses on professional doctorate programs, exploring the lived experiences of learners, thrill-seeking behaviors in academic settings, and group dynamics in healthcare education. Her work emphasizes practical learning, budget contributions in academia, and clinical practice integration.
Research Trends: Recent articles analyze professional identity formation in doctoral graduates, work-based learning, and ethical frameworks like the Hippocratic Oath in modern healthcare education. Themes include student experiences, small-group learning, and institutional budgeting.
Roles and Affiliations: She is part of Teesside University's dental care professional team and actively engages with schools and colleges to promote dental nursing courses.
